Department of Environmental Engineering

Water Quality Watch Fact Sheets

River ImageBeginning in 1997, the Water Quality Team published the first of a series of Water Quality Watch Fact sheets describing a variety of surface water quality issues in Chesterfield County. The purpose of the fact sheets is to promote awareness of Chesterfield’s water bodies, water quality problem, and measures the county is taking to address those problems.
